Analysis
The most recent figure for wood fuel — export quantity in Colombia is 1 m3, measured in 2024. That is the lowest value across all 7 years on record.
That represents a change of down 96.4% on the previous year and down 97.9% over ten years.
Over the whole period, wood fuel — export quantity in Colombia peaked at 48 m3 in 2014 and was at its lowest, 1 m3, in 2024.
That places Colombia 135th out of 163 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the bottom quarter.

About this data
The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
